The Humane Society Legislative Fund (HSLF) currently seeks a Web Developer intern for the 2011 summer session. The HSLF is a separate lobbying affiliate of The Humane Society of the United States (HSUS), which seeks to pass humane laws. As a 501(c)(4), HSLF also engages in political activity and works to elect humane lawmakers.
